Ojo El Sásachi
Ojo El Sásachi is a spring in Sonora, Northern Mexico and has an elevation of 1,233 metres. Ojo El Sásachi is situated nearby to the locality Zazachi, as well as near El Torreón.| Tap on a place to explore it |
